Roberts Kit-Craft
Roberts Industries, Inc.
303 Main St.
Durham, Connecticut
Later located at Post Rd. Branford, Connecticut. This company offered a range of boat as kits, semi-complete, or completed boats. This included many sail boat models such as the Roberts Sea Shell prams, Blue Jay (designed by Sparkman & Stephens), Penguin (Phil Rhodes designed), and Gypsy classes.
